The Fluorocarbon Emission Control Act includes nine main obligations and practices for managers, such as "appointing a management officer," "creating a list of management equipment for Type 1 specified products," and "conducting regular inspections and simple checks." Until now, on-site work has been analog, and the workload for craftsmen and staff has been heavy. After finishing on-site tasks, they also have to deal with cleanup, photos, and document organization, leading to a situation that contradicts the establishment of a "work-life balance" with regular overtime and a one-day weekend system. Amid concerns about future labor shortages, the catalyst for the full-scale digital transformation (DX) of on-site work was the "Fluorocarbon Emission Control Law," enacted in 2015. When it became legally mandated to manage and inspect fluorocarbons, various organizations began to venture into the maintenance and management of refrigerants in pursuit of new business opportunities. However, the complexity of the "Fluorocarbon Emission Control Law," the need for detailed compliance, and the revisions aimed at stricter penalties led many organizations to abandon these efforts due to the associated burdens.
